- Summary:
- The thirty-six cases presented in this volume are the pedagogic result of the author's years working in a pediatrics medical setting.These cases include scenarios that aim to help students improve such skills as evaluating clinical presentations, formulating differential diagnoses, determining appropriate work-ups and interpreting their results.
